8-K: HNI, Steelcase Set Merger Consideration Election Deadline
Merger Update
HNI Corporation and Steelcase Inc. announced the December 4, 2025, deadline for Steelcase shareholders to elect their preferred merger consideration.
Summary
- HNI Corporation and Steelcase Inc. have set the deadline for Steelcase shareholders to elect their form of merger consideration (cash, stock, or mixed) for 5:00 p.m., Eastern Time, on December 4, 2025.
- The merger consideration is part of HNI's proposed acquisition of Steelcase, as per the Agreement and Plan of Merger dated August 3, 2025.
- Shareholders who do not submit an election form by the deadline will be deemed to have made a mixed election, entitling them to receive 0.2192 shares of HNI common stock and $7.20 in cash per Steelcase share.
- Elections for all cash or all stock consideration are subject to automatic adjustment to ensure the total cash paid and total number of HNI common shares issued in the transaction align with the mixed consideration scenario.
- The HNI common stock reference price for determining merger consideration will be the volume-weighted average closing price of HNI common stock on the New York Stock Exchange for the 10 consecutive trading days ending on the second full trading day preceding the closing date.
- Completion of the transaction remains subject to approval by HNI and Steelcase shareholders and the satisfaction or waiver of other customary closing conditions.
- Election forms and accompanying instructions were mailed to Steelcase shareholders of record as of October 30, 2025, beginning on November 6, 2025.

Stakeholder Impact
- Shareholders (Steelcase): Must make an election regarding their merger consideration (cash, stock, or mixed) by December 4, 2025, or default to mixed consideration. Their final consideration value for all-cash or all-stock elections will depend on HNI's stock price performance leading up to the closing.
- Shareholders (HNI): Will experience dilution due to the issuance of additional shares of HNI common stock as part of the merger consideration.
- Customers, Employees, Business Partners (HNI & Steelcase): Potential adverse reactions and reputational risk are cited as risks related to the transaction's announcement, pendency, or completion.
- Management (HNI & Steelcase): Attention and time will be diverted to the transaction from ongoing business operations and opportunities.

Key Dates
| Date | Description |
|---|---|
| 2025-08-03 | HNI Corporation entered into the Agreement and Plan of Merger with Steelcase Inc. |
| 2025-10-30 | Record date for Steelcase shareholders to receive election forms. |
| 2025-11-04 | Registration Statement on Form S-4 (SEC File No. 333-290205) became effective. |
| 2025-11-05 | Definitive joint proxy statement/prospectus filed by Steelcase with the SEC. |
| 2025-11-06 | Election forms and accompanying instructions began to be mailed to Steelcase shareholders of record. |
| 2025-11-25 | Date of joint press release announcing the election deadline and date of this 8-K report. |
| 2025-12-04 | Election Deadline for Steelcase shareholders to elect the form of merger consideration (5:00 p.m., Eastern Time). |
